1.Key Features of Node.js Node.js website development is defined by its non-blocking, event-driven architecture, which allows it to handle thousands of concurrent connections with ease. Its single-threaded nature, paired with an asynchronous event-driven model, equips developers with the tools to build highly scalable applications. This high-performance framework is built on Google Chrome's V8 JavaScript engine, further enhancing its speed and efficiency.Node.js boasts of an array of features that make it a top choice for web development. Its non-blocking, event-driven architecture allows for handling multiple client requests simultaneously, greatly improving the speed and efficiency of web applications. Furthermore, its single-threaded nature ensures seamless execution flow, reducing the complexities and overheads associated with multithreading. In addition, Node.js is highly scalable and provides superior performance, meeting the evolving needs of modern businesses. It is no wonder that an increasing number of companies are turning to Node.js for their website development needs. 2. Faster Development Process Node.js is known for its remarkable speed. It runs on Google's V8 JavaScript engine and is built on the event-driven, non-blocking I/O model. This means that Node.js can handle multiple requests simultaneously, allowing it to process data much faster than traditional web servers like Apache. The Benefits of Using React Native Cross-Platform Compatibility React Native's cross-platform compatibility is one of its major advantages and a significant factor in its widespread adoption. This feature allows developers to use a single codebase for creating applications for both Android and iOS. This not only streamlines the development process, but also ensures consistent performance and appearance across different platforms. This uniformity fosters a cohesive user experience, irrespective of the device used. Moreover, it allows businesses to reach a wider audience without the need for separate development teams, significantly reducing both time and costs. Increased Developer Efficiency Increased developer efficiency is yet another remarkable benefit of React Native. By enabling the reuse of code across multiple platforms, it significantly reduces the workload for developers. This platform's hot-reloading feature also contributes to productivity, as developers can see the impact of their changes in real time, without having to rebuild the entire application. Additionally, because React Native is based on JavaScript—a language many developers are already familiar with—it reduces the learning curve typically associated with new technologies, thereby allowing for swift and efficient development processes. Community Support and Rich Ecosystem React Native boasts an extensive and vibrant community of developers worldwide. This robust community support acts as a valuable resource for troubleshooting, enhancing existing features, and integrating new functionalities. The community constantly works towards refining and expanding the React Native ecosystem, contributing to its progressive evolution. Furthermore, this dynamic ecosystem is replete with libraries, tools, and extensions, providing developers with a rich set of resources to leverage in their projects. As a result, the platform's combined strength of community support and a rich ecosystem empowers developers to create high-performing, feature-rich applications efficiently and effectively. Performance React Native delivers impressive performance by leveraging native components, offering an experience that is close to native while still retaining the speed and efficiency of a cross-platform application. React Native's efficiency is due to its ability to communicate directly with the underlying platform, rather than through a virtual machine as is common in many cross-platform frameworks. Its architecture, coupled with the use of JavaScript, allows for better performance compared to traditional hybrid technologies. Therefore, apps built with React Native are smooth, reliable, and quick to load, offering a user experience that is nearly indistinguishable from native apps. Understanding CRM in Healthcare CRM, standing for Customer Relationship Management, is a comprehensive strategy that integrates technology and customer-centric business strategies to understand and cater to consumer needs in a better manner. In the context of healthcare, CRM has evolved beyond just a tool for managing patient relationships, and has become a conduit for improving patient care and retention. It facilitates the efficient management of health data, enables more personalized patient interaction, and aids in the coordination of care. Adopting CRM in healthcare can result in improved patient satisfaction, increased operational efficiency, and ultimately, a higher patient retention rate.
